Output 84efaf2ce373a3305e28ff6a369f52d04ffe300648cde99d1bb36141c225b407:1

value
49691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 831a32de2c235faa6c2f3529c9f47011ae37065e OP_EQUAL
address
3DeDpzT1T4v41mVQag9UkUFNd3yBQ4jXh9
transaction
84efaf2ce373a3305e28ff6a369f52d04ffe300648cde99d1bb36141c225b407
spent
true